USEF Lite was developed as an accessible competition product for organizers and participants who wish to “test drive” hosting and participating in a USEF Licensed Competition. This program provides access to equestrians who are interested in competing under the framework of organized equestrian sport, involving rules and policies that support the safety and welfare of equestrians and their horses and offer a fair and level playing field.

The purpose of USEF Lite is to promote and grow the competition environment. It will provide organizers of new, smaller, or formerly unlicensed competitions across the national breeds and disciplines with an entry point to the Licensed Competition environment by offering discounted fees and fewer barriers to entry. The program allows them to establish and grow their competitions under the USEF framework of organized sport with a goal of transitioning those to Regular competitions after three consecutive years of use. USEF Lite Competition Eligibility 

Competitions for breeds or disciplines that are eligible for a Local License may apply to host a USEF Lite competition if it:

1) has never been previously licensed by the Federation;

2) has not been licensed by the Federation in the past three years;

3) has operated exclusively as a USEF Lite competition in any of the past three years; or

4) does not meet any of the three prior eligibility requirements, and it is granted an exemption at the sole discretion of the Federation’s Chief Executive Officer.

USEF Lite competitions may operate for a maximum of three consecutive years. 

**(EXCEPTION: GR310.7(1)(a)(4) "A competition that meets the criteria listed on the Federation website" - Horse Entry Thresholds)** 

Important Note - All previously licensed USEF Lite competitions, prior to 2023, will be considered new USEF Lite competitions and will be able to operate for three consecutive years. 

Competition Management Savings
  • Discounted application fee: The USEF Lite license application fee is $50 (a $50 savings from the Regular license application fee) and the $1.50 per horse fee is waived for USEF Lite licensed competitions. 

**Note: USEF has waived the application fee for the 2024 competition year**

  • Licensed Officials: Management has more flexibility regarding who they can hire as officials:
    • Either a fully licensed Steward/TD OR 
    • Someone enrolled and currently pursuing a USEF Steward/TD license who has completed the Designated Applicant Training

  • Financial support: Additional financial support is provided through access to Competition Manager Perks which provides discounts on products and services, such as Electronic Vet, Horseshoe Greetings, Big Ass Fans, and Office Depot.
Savings for Exhibitors
  • Exhibitors pay no USEF participation fees (Membership, Administrative, Drugs & Medication fees, etc.); however, drug testing may still occur, and all participants are subject to the applicable D&M rules.
  • Exhibitors are not required to be USEF or breed/discipline affiliate members (unless HOTY points are desired) or pay show pass fees.
Additional Benefits for USEF Lite Competitions
  • USEF Safe Sport: Participants in a USEF Lite competition will be under the jurisdiction of the U.S. Center for Safe Sport and will be subject to the U.S. Center for SafeSport Code and USEF Safe Sport Policy and afforded all related protections.
  • Regulatory function: A USEF Lite competition will be granted access to the Federation’s regulatory functions at no additional cost, which can assist organizers in enforcing rules and dealing with non-payment of competition fees (i.e., collection of bounced checks and declined credit cards).
  • Mileage boundary: There is a 50-mile boundary protection to ensure a competition is not competing for exhibitors with another nearby licensed competition.
  • Staff support: USEF staff support is always a call or email away to assist when questions arise before, during, and/or after a show.
